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Drainage System: Different systems such as French drains, surface drains, or sump pumps come with varying costs.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ials, like PVC pipes or concrete, can impact the overall expense.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Eagle, ID can vary, influencing the total cost of the project.
- Project Size: Larger projects will naturally cost more due to increased materials and labor.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require more specialized equipment and labor, raising the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Soil Conditions: Rocky or clay-heavy soil can complicate installation, increasing labor and equipment cost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ost ($) |
---|---|
French Drain Installation | 2,500 - 4,500 |
Sump Pump Installation | 1,000 - 2,500 |
Surface Drain Installation | 1,500 - 3,000 |
Drainage System Repair | 500 - 2,000 |
Pipe Replacement | 1,000 - 3,000 |
Inspection and Permits | 100 - 500 |
